🐪 The Journey Begins: Riding into the Dunes

Your desert adventure starts with a scenic drive from Jaisalmer city to the Sam or Khuri Sand Dunes, located about 30–45 km away. You can choose a camel ride for the traditional experience or hop into a jeep safari for an adrenaline-filled journey.

As you leave behind the city and enter the desert, you’ll be surrounded by rolling golden dunes, nomadic herders, and a silence that’s almost spiritual. Riding a camel at sunset, with the sky turning hues of orange and pink, is a feeling like no other.

🎶 Cultural Evenings You’ll Never Forget

As the sun sets, the camp comes alive with Rajasthani folk music and dance performances. Kalbelia dancers swirl in colorful costumes, while Manganiyar musicians play traditional instruments like the kamaicha and dholak.

🌟 It’s not a tourist show—it’s a true celebration of desert culture.
